Bioceramics Market Size and Overview

The bioceramics market is expected to grow from an estimated USD 8.1 billion in 2024 to USD 15.7 billion in 2033, at a CAGR of 7.6%.

The increasing incidence of musculoskeletal conditions, such as osteoarthritis, osteoporosis, and bone fractures, is driving growth in the bioceramics market. Bioceramics, including materials like alumina, zirconia, and hydroxyapatite, are extensively used in orthopaedic implants, bone grafts, and joint replacements due to their biocompatibility, durability and ability to integrate with human tissues. As ageing populations increase globally, the demand for bioceramic-based medical solutions rises, particularly in developing regions.

Technological advancements in 3D printing and nanotechnology are enhancing the effectiveness and customization of bioceramic implants. This convergence of healthcare needs and innovations is boosting market expansion, making bioceramics essential for improving patient outcomes and addressing musculoskeletal disorders.

 In June 2023, BONESUPPORT, an emerging leader in orthobiologics for the management of bone injuries, launched the next generation of the firm's breakthrough antibiotic-eluting bone graft replacement, CERAMENT G. Improvements to CERAMENT G have been made to improve ease of use and to decrease environmental impact.

Technological infrastructure and research facilities are significant drivers of the bioceramics market. Newly developed biometric materials through cutting-edge infrastructure enable advanced research in brand-new bioceramic items, particularly for orthopedic implants, dental materials, and prosthetics.

 Increased growth of specialized research centers and academic institutions concentrating on materials science and regenerative medicine resulted in accelerating discovery of new bioceramic formulations with enhanced attributes such as biocompatibility, durability, and bioactivity. Technological advances in 3D printing and nanotechnology are also improving the accuracy and customization of bioceramic materials, thereby facilitating their entry into the healthcare domain.
